Asian markets rebounding
That one sends me mixed signals. At one point the asian markets threatened to drag us down, then then overseas weakness bode well because it seemed to insure that our interest rates were headed down (Can't spoil the one oasis of prosperity), then there was fear that money would leave our markets for the bah-gins that asia/latin america seemed to be, now that overseas markets are "stable", it's viewed as a positive again. Talk about throwin' a spin.
